Living in Bentonville, AR
Bentonville features a reliable transport infrastructure with a focus on both private and public transit options. The city's roadways and highways are well-maintained, facilitating easy commuting and travel to surrounding areas. Public transportation services are available, providing connectivity within the city and beyond. The community is also becoming increasingly bike-friendly, with dedicated lanes and trails. While specific ride-sharing services are present, they complement the existing transport options, offering residents and visitors an array of choices for their mobility needs.
The community is served by a comprehensive educational system, including several public schools at the elementary, middle, and high school levels, as well as private educational institutions. Healthcare services are accessible, with a local hospital and various clinics offering a range of medical care. The public library system supports lifelong learning and community engagement. Retail and dining options reflect the local culture, with an emphasis on farm-to-table restaurants and boutique shopping experiences. City initiatives are in place to continually improve services to meet the needs of a growing population.
Bentonville is celebrated for its vibrant community spirit and cultural richness. The city prides itself on its thriving arts scene, numerous parks, and trails that encourage outdoor activities. Annual events and festivals highlight the local heritage and foster a sense of community among residents. The town's character is further defined by its blend of historic charm and innovative growth, making it an attractive place for families and professionals alike.
Bentonville's housing market is diverse, offering a range of options from charming single-family homes to modern apartments and townhouses. The architectural styles vary, with a noticeable presence of contemporary and craftsman designs. Single-family homes are the most prevalent, making up a significant portion of the market, while multifamily units provide alternatives for those seeking a more urban living experience. The homeownership rate in Bentonville is robust, reflecting a community invested in long-term residency.
